Step 1: Understanding the Client, Not the Ring
The process always begins with conversation, not design.
Before a single sketch is drawn, the focus is on understanding:
- The occasion and emotional context
- Design references or inspirations
- Budget parameters and priorities
- Lifestyle factors (daily wear vs occasion wear)
This stage is critical. A ring designed for a corporate executive who wears jewelry daily will be engineered differently from one created for ceremonial or occasional use.
In high jewelry, design is not about trends. It is about fit - not just on the finger, but within someone’s life.

Step 3: Translating Vision into Design
Once the diamond is selected, design begins around the stone - not the other way around.
The Design Phase Includes:
- Hand sketches or CAD renders
- Proportion studies for setting height and width
- Structural engineering for long-term wear
- Design revisions with the client
This phase balances three elements:
- Aesthetics – how the piece looks
- Ergonomics – how it feels to wear
- Longevity – how it holds up over decades
Luxury jewelry is not just about appearance. It is about engineering something that remains beautiful after years of daily use.
Step 4: The Craft - Where Design Becomes Reality
Once approved, the design moves into production.
This is where most bespoke jewelry differentiates itself from commercial manufacturing.
The creation process typically includes:
- Wax or resin model creation
- Metal casting (gold or platinum)
- Manual stone setting by master setters
- Hand polishing and finishing
Every step is controlled. No automated assembly lines. No bulk production methods.
Materials Commonly Used:
- 18K yellow, white, or rose gold
- Platinum (for high-security settings)
- Natural pavé or micro-set diamonds
At this stage, craftsmanship becomes visible in details most people never consciously notice:
- Symmetry of prongs
- Alignment of pavé stones
- Comfort of inner shank edges
- Balance and weight distribution
These are the details that separate fine jewelry from decorative jewelry.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ification
Before delivery, every bespoke piece undergoes:
- Structural inspection
- Stone security checks
- Finish and polish review
- Certificate verification
For engagement rings and high-value pieces, this stage ensures:
- Diamonds match certification
- Setting meets durability standards
- Metal purity is verified

FAQ: Bespoke Diamond Jewelry in Dubai
1. How long does bespoke diamond jewelry take to make?
Most bespoke pieces take between 3 to 6 weeks, depending on design complexity and stone availability.
2. Is bespoke jewelry more expensive than ready-made?
Not necessarily. Bespoke often provides better value because pricing is based on actual materials and craftsmanship, not brand markups.
3. Can I customize diamond jewelry in Dubai if I don’t know what I want?
Yes. The process begins with consultation and design guidance. You do not need technical or design knowledge.
4. Are bespoke diamonds certified?
Yes. Reputable bespoke jewelers use GIA-certified natural diamonds or equivalent international laboratories.
5. Can I redesign old family jewelry into a new piece?
Absolutely. Many clients modernize heirloom diamonds into contemporary bespoke designs.
6. What is the difference between custom and bespoke?
Custom usually modifies an existing design. Bespoke means every element is created from scratch.
7. Is bespoke jewelry a good investment?
While jewelry should not be viewed purely as a financial asset, bespoke pieces retain strong value due to quality materials and timeless design.
